Invisible Doors & The Unexpected Role of Edge Banding: A Manufacturer‘s Perspective148


As a leading Chinese manufacturer of high-quality edge banding for furniture, we’re often approached by clients with unique and challenging projects. Recently, the concept of “invisible doors” – doors seamlessly integrated into surrounding cabinetry or walls – has gained considerable traction. While seemingly straightforward, the execution of a truly invisible door presents several manufacturing complexities, and the role of edge banding, surprisingly, is key to its success, even though the final product doesn't *show* any banding.

The allure of invisible doors is undeniable. They offer a clean, minimalist aesthetic, maximizing space and creating a sense of fluidity within a room. Imagine a pantry wall that melts away to reveal shelves, or a bookcase that cleverly conceals a hidden home office. However, achieving this seamless integration is more than just skillful carpentry. It requires meticulous attention to detail and the use of materials and techniques that ensure a flawless finish. This is where our edge banding expertise comes into play, often in ways not immediately obvious.

At first glance, an invisible door seems to negate the need for edge banding altogether. After all, the edges aren’t supposed to be visible! This misconception is common, but it misses a crucial point: the invisible door’s success depends heavily on the quality and precision of the underlying construction. The materials used, the joining techniques employed, and the overall craftsmanship all impact the final result. Edge banding plays a crucial, albeit hidden, role in ensuring these critical aspects are met to the highest standards.

Let's delve into the specific ways edge banding contributes to the success of an invisible door project, even if it's not visually apparent in the finished product:

1. Enhancing Substrate Stability: Invisible doors often incorporate materials like plywood, MDF, or high-pressure laminates. These substrates, while aesthetically versatile, can be susceptible to warping or moisture damage. Applying edge banding, even on the unseen edges, provides significant reinforcement. This added stability prevents the door from bowing or twisting over time, preserving its seamless integration with the surrounding structure. The type of edge banding used – whether PVC, melamine, ABS, or veneer – is chosen to complement the substrate and provide optimal reinforcement.

2. Facilitating Precise Joining Techniques: Invisible doors often rely on sophisticated joining techniques like flush-fitting joints or intricate rabbet joints. The accuracy of these joints is paramount to achieving the seamless look. Edge banding offers a crucial advantage in this respect. The consistent thickness and straight edges of the banding provide a clean, stable surface for precise cutting and joinery. Without well-prepared edges, achieving perfect alignment becomes significantly more challenging, leading to gaps or misalignments that compromise the invisible effect.

3. Protecting Raw Edges and Improving Durability: Even if the edges of the door are hidden within the frame, they’re still susceptible to damage during the manufacturing and installation process. Edge banding protects these raw edges from chipping, scratches, and moisture absorption. This is especially important in high-humidity environments. This protection contributes to the longevity of the door and ensures that the concealed edges remain in pristine condition, contributing to the overall structural integrity of the invisible door.

4. Ensuring Consistent Color and Texture Matching: A key element of a successful invisible door is the seamless blend with the surrounding cabinetry or wall. Edge banding plays a vital role in achieving this consistency. By carefully selecting the edge banding material to match the core material of the door and surrounding elements in both color and texture, we ensure a uniform appearance that helps disguise the door's presence. Even slight discrepancies in color or texture can compromise the illusion of seamless integration.

5. Improving the Efficiency of the Manufacturing Process: While the final product doesn't showcase the banding, the application of edge banding in the manufacturing stage actually streamlines the overall production process. The improved stability and edge protection provided by edge banding reduce the risk of damage or defects, leading to less rework and improved efficiency. This translates to cost savings and faster turnaround times for our clients.

In conclusion, although the final aesthetic of an invisible door might suggest that edge banding is unnecessary, it's in fact a crucial element behind the scenes. The unseen contribution of edge banding to substrate stability, precise joining, durability, color matching, and manufacturing efficiency all contribute to the creation of truly invisible and flawlessly integrated doors.
